Important facts on capacity, type, and age of septic systems on Georgia Mountain Land and North Carolina mountain cabins.Does the lot have a suitable site for changing, repairing or adding the system? This can be a significant problem on lots that are smaller then an acre. Regardless, expansion or repair of the drain field must maintain a minimum setback of as much as 100 feet from surface waters or streams, depending upon the water quality classification assigned by the North Carolina Department of Environment and Natural Resources. Is the drain field site adequately protected from surface and subsurface (groundwater flow)? Surface run off from up slope areas, roof drains, roads, and spring outlets can rapidly cause a septic system to fail. Septic systems are designed to handle only the wastewater from the home. The county health department can help you answer these questions. You can also do some simple checks yourself. Run the water in the house and watch the lowest plumbing fixture ( A drain or toilet in the basement), for sewage backup. Outside, unusually lush, dark, green grass or vegetation, as well as moist areas over the drain field, indicate that the sewage may not be absorbed properly and that system rehabilitation may be needed. Check water drainage on the property during or right after a heavy rain. Raw sewage from a failing septic system may rise to the surface and stink during rainy periods.
